癌相关抗原基因家族中的反转录转座现象。

Retroposition in a family of carcinoma-associated antigen genes.

作者信息

Linnenbach A J, Seng B A, Wu S, Robbins S, Scollon M, Pyrc J J, Druck T, Huebner K

机构信息

Wistar Institute, Philadelphia, Pennsylvania 19104.

出版信息

Mol Cell Biol. 1993 Mar;13(3):1507-15. doi: 10.1128/mcb.13.3.1507-1515.1993.

DOI:10.1128/mcb.13.3.1507-1515.1993
PMID:8382772
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C359462/
Abstract

The gene encoding the carcinoma-associated antigen defined by the monoclonal antibody GA733 is a member of a family of at least two type I membrane proteins. This study describes the mechanism of evolution of the GA733-1 and GA733-2 genes. A full-length cDNA clone for GA733-1 was obtained by screening a human placental library with a genomic DNA probe. Comparative analysis of the cDNA sequence with the previously determined genomic sequence confirmed that GA733-1 is an intronless gene. The GA733-2 gene encoding the monoclonal antibody-defined antigen was molecularly cloned with a cDNA probe and partially sequenced. Comparison of GA733-2 gene sequences with the previously established cDNA sequence revealed that this gene consists of nine exons. The putative promoter regions of the GA733-1 and GA733-2 genes are unrelated. These findings suggest that the GA733-1 gene was formed by the retroposition of the GA733-2 gene via an mRNA intermediate. Prior to retroposition, the GA733-2 gene had been affected by exon shuffling. Analysis of GA733-2 exons revealed that many delineate structural motifs. The GA733-1 retroposon was localized either to chromosome region 1p32-1p31 or to 1p13-1q12, and the GA733-2 founder gene was localized to chromosome 4q.

摘要

由单克隆抗体GA733所定义的癌相关抗原的编码基因是一个至少由两种I型膜蛋白组成的家族的成员。本研究描述了GA733 - 1和GA733 - 2基因的进化机制。通过用基因组DNA探针筛选人胎盘文库获得了GA733 - 1的全长cDNA克隆。将该cDNA序列与先前确定的基因组序列进行比较分析,证实GA733 - 1是一个无内含子的基因。用cDNA探针分子克隆了编码单克隆抗体定义抗原的GA733 - 2基因并进行了部分测序。将GA733 - 2基因序列与先前建立的cDNA序列进行比较,发现该基因由9个外显子组成。GA733 - 1和GA733 - 2基因的推定启动子区域不相关。这些发现表明,GA733 - 1基因是通过GA733 - 2基因经mRNA中间体反转录而形成的。在反转录之前,GA733 - 2基因受到外显子重排的影响。对GA733 - 2外显子的分析表明,许多外显子描绘了结构基序。GA733 - 1反转座子定位于染色体区域1p32 - 1p31或1p13 - 1q12,而GA733 - 2原始基因定位于染色体4q。
